Baofeng BF-888S Walkie Talkies two way radios
These are surprisingly good for the money, heavy made, good quality, lithium battery etc.. Hard to really judge the range without real-world conditions, but If you set your expectations a little lower than the marketing blurb, you will probably be happy!
I quite like the voice / speech channel select notification. Much better than the screen in practice as you do not need to look at the unit or fiddle with little buttons. Especially at this time of the year in the cold!

They are BF-88E, a modified BF-888 with a fixed antenna, USB rather than 230V charger (which on the BF-888 has a rather sketchy mains cable!) and ERP limited to 0,5W to comply with PMR446 rules. Top orange button is squelch off/monitor, lower one is torch (but could be changed to emergency alarm using CHIRP or other software if you have the programming cable)
